Amish Onion Fritters

Amish Onion Fritters

  • Total Time: 30
  • Yield: 12 fritters

Description

Crispy, flavorful Amish Onion Fritters are a comforting and delicious appetizer or side dish that are quick and easy to prepare. Made with sweet onions, a simple batter, and fried to golden-brown perfection, these fritters are a family-pleasing favorite.


Ingredients

– 2 large sweet onions, thinly sliced

– 1 cup all-purpose flour

– 1 teaspoon baking powder

– 1/2 teaspoon salt

– 1/4 teaspoon black pepper

– 2 large eggs

– 1/2 cup milk

– Vegetable oil for frying


Instructions

1. – In a large bowl, combine the sliced onions, flour, baking powder, salt, and pepper. Toss to coat the onions evenly.

2. – In a separate bowl, whisk together the eggs and milk.

3. – Pour the egg mixture into the onion mixture and stir until just combined (do not overmix).

4. – In a large skillet, heat 1/2 inch of vegetable oil over medium-high heat.

5. – Working in batches, drop heaping tablespoonfuls of the onion batter into the hot oil. Fry for 2-3 minutes per side, or until golden brown.

6. – Transfer the fried fritters to a paper towel-lined plate to drain excess oil.

7. – Serve the Amish Onion Fritters warm, either as an appetizer or a delicious side dish.

Notes

– For a crispier texture, let the fried fritters sit for a few minutes on the paper towels before serving.

– Try serving the fritters with a cool, creamy dipping sauce like ranch or sour cream.

– Adjust the seasoning to your taste, adding more salt, pepper, or even a dash of cayenne for a little heat.
